Larry Engesath
I am using Testors yellow zinc chromate enamel on mine. It's a flat paint, but if you "polish" the dried paint with a paper towel, it gives it enough of a sheen to allow the decals to stick properly.

The yellow I used was yellow ocher from Vallejo air. Maybe watching you guys tackle this kit will inspire me to finish mine! Beware of the decals though, they are more like pieces of vinyl or something, and will not soften and conform to the surface. It's the one thing that's been holding me up all this time.
